Gemini 2.0 Flash-Lite vs Llama 3.1 405B: Which Should You Choose?
Choosing between Gemini 2.0 Flash-Lite and Llama 3.1 405B depends on your priorities: cost efficiency, context length, or raw capability. Gemini 2.0 Flash-Lite is the more affordable option at $0.075/1M input tokens — 98% cheaper than Llama 3.1 405B. Meanwhile, Gemini 2.0 Flash-Lite offers a significantly larger context window at 1,000,000 tokens vs 128,000 for Llama 3.1 405B.
These models come from different providers — Google and Meta (via Together AI) — which means different API ecosystems, SDKs, rate limits, and terms of service. If you're already integrated with Google, switching to Meta (via Together AI)involves migration effort beyond just pricing. Factor in your existing infrastructure when deciding.
These models target different tiers: Gemini 2.0 Flash-Lite is a efficient model while Llama 3.1 405B is flagship. This means they're optimized for different workloads. Llama 3.1 405B targets more demanding workloads, while Gemini 2.0 Flash-Lite provides a cost-effective option for everyday tasks.
Output costs matter too. Gemini 2.0 Flash-Lite charges $0.30/1M output tokens vs $3.50 for Llama 3.1 405B. For generation-heavy workloads (content creation, code generation, summarization), output pricing often dominates your bill. Gemini 2.0 Flash-Lite has the edge here at $0.30/1M output tokens.
Multimodal capabilities: Gemini 2.0 Flash-Lite supports vision (image inputs) while Llama 3.1 405B is text-only. If your application needs image understanding, this narrows your choice.
